永井@知能.九工大です.

From: keiju / ishitsuka.com (石塚圭樹)
Subject: [ruby-list:40956] Re: irb --noreadline
Date: Fri, 29 Jul 2005 15:40:15 +0900
Message-ID: <E1DyOXO-00029k-00 / emperor>
> >なんとなくreadlineが働いているような気がするのですが勘違い
> >でしょうか…
> 勘違いではないようです.
> 調べてみます.

こうですか?

Index: context.rb
===================================================================
RCS file: /var/cvs/src/ruby/lib/irb/context.rb,v
retrieving revision 1.8.2.2
diff -u -r1.8.2.2 context.rb
--- context.rb	19 Apr 2005 19:24:57 -0000	1.8.2.2
+++ context.rb	29 Jul 2005 07:07:08 -0000
@@ -59,7 +59,7 @@
       case input_method
       when nil
 	if (defined?(ReadlineInputMethod) &&
-            (use_readline? || IRB.conf[:PROMPT_MODE] != :INF_RUBY && STDIN.tty?))
+            (use_readline? && IRB.conf[:PROMPT_MODE] != :INF_RUBY && STDIN.tty?))
 	  @io = ReadlineInputMethod.new
 	else
 	  @io = StdioInputMethod.new

-- 
                                       永井 秀利 (九工大 知能情報)
                                           nagai / ai.kyutech.ac.jp